sodomy
Sodomy (noun) means a legal and historical term for anal or oral sex, sometimes also used for bestiality; historically used to criminalize homosexual acts.

Learner’s notesIn plain EnglishAn old legal term for certain sex acts, historically used in discriminatory laws.
Largely a legal/historical term now; considered outdated and loaded when applied to consensual adult relationships.

Etymology
Derived from the biblical city of Sodom, described in Genesis as destroyed for its inhabitants' wickedness.
